#712d17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#712d17 is composed of 44.3% red, 17.6%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 14.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 26.7%. #712d17 color hex could be obtained by blending #e25a2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#712d17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#712d17 has RGB values of R:113, G:45,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.8,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7417111.

Shades and Tints of #712d17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0603 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
